The Cash Back will then be credited to your account.So, if you used paper coupons at the store, and it made the item less or even free, you'll still receive your full cash back for the item - sweet! They don't deduct any other coupon savings that you've already used toward the purchase from your cash back either.Then, once you've purchased one or more of the items on their list, by Wednesday evening (their weekly deadline), you simply need to take a photo of, or scan a copy of the receipt(s) showing the items that you purchased on their list and upload it to them.You can use any form of payment to pay for your groceries (Cash, Debit Card, Credit Card, Check, Food Stamps or EBT Card, Coupons.). You can purchase these items at ANY store and even online! Best of all, you don't have to connect the coupons to any Loyalty Cards, you don't have to print coupons and take them to the store-it's sweet! You might want to print the list of groceries and take it grocery shopping with you to remind you to purchase some items - that's what I do anyway. Every Thursday, Checkout 51 comes out with a list of Groceries, and they tell you how much Cash Back you will receive if you purchase that particular grocery item(s).How to use Checkout 51 to earn Cash Back for purchasing Groceries One of the best parts about using many of the cash back grocery apps, is that they often offer cash back for items that you almost never get regular paper coupons for, such as: fruits, vegetables, and dairy (milk, eggs, cheese.)! The cash back items/offers are not additional coupons that you have to take to the grocery store so if you hate to clip coupons, you can still save by using the cash back apps! But, you'll definitely save more money by combining (stacking) your savings by using the apps in addition to paper and other electronic coupons. Like most other cash back apps, you can use Checkout 51 in addition to using paper manufacturer coupons, store coupons (paper or electronic), store offers (i.e., BOGO), store loyalty cards, and even other Cash Back Apps, like ibotta, SavingStar, or Snap by Groupon! It's yet another form of "stacking" and you can save big and even make money on some products by using multiple means of saving, such as these. And, unlike many of the other grocery apps, Checkout 51 works on your computer, cell or tablet. Checkout 51 is a cash back grocery app that lets you earn cash back when grocery shopping.
